Collection description

This project was a study of the Russian political elite in the era of Vladimir Putin, and sought to identify both the collective social characteristics of the elite and their formal patterns of association. The project was intended to advance scholarly understanding of such matters, and to help to inform the Western foreign policy community. Main Topics: The data cover demographic details and date of election of members of the Council of the Russian Federation, state Duma, and government and presidential administration.
